Staple plugins for the landing pages

There is plenty of plugins which are provided by the WordPress that can increase the functionality and efficiency of the landing pages. That is why some useful plugins that every website should have are: the page creators – Elementor or Beaver Builder as they let you create unique designs without programming knowledge; the gathering of the visitors’ data and creation of the list of e-mail addresses – programs like OptinMonster or ConvertKit.

Designing Engaging Landing Pages

We concluded that the design of your landing page is a critical factor in the management of visitors’ attention. Do not overcrowd your design with stimuli or elements; it is important to keep the design open and a bit minimalistic in order to emphasize your offer as well as CTAs. Since graphics are part of the call to action, ensure that there is a contrast of color between the desired action and the rest of the graphic elements, including the use of powerful images and excellently typed texts.

SEO Considerations

Taking the step to work on your site from an SEO perspective can also assist with getting organic traffic to your site and help increase ranking in search engine results (SERPs). Always incorporate the right keywords into your title tags, meta descriptions, and the visible text of the page, and compress images with the correct file name and alt tag.

Loading Speed Optimization

Therefore, the loading time of the page is one of the key factors that define overall user satisfaction and SE positioning. Speed up the landing pages by reducing the file sizes and enabling browser caching, as well as serve assets through a CDN. Ensure that you are very keen on the performance audits and seek to solve problems that may be slowing your pages.

Tracking and Analytics

In order to improve the usability level of the landing pages, and consequently increase the conversion rate, one has to track its effectiveness. The owners should incorporate website analytics, for example, Google Analytics to monitor useful metrics that include source of traffic, bounce rates, and conversation rates. Configure objectives and activities of events in order to monitor well-defined actions on the part of users in the agenda area of your landing pages.

FAQs

How many CTAs should be there on a landing page?
In general, it is suggested to use one prominent CTA that pertains to the primary form’s conversion goal. It should also be noted that if other secondary CTAs complement the primary goal without complicating it, more than one secondary CTA can be used.

Here are some ideas of lead magnets that one can use to capture the visitor information?
Lead magnets can be e-books, white papers, templates, free webinars, free trial, and exclusive a special offer. Select a lead magnet that will be worth the information of the clients you wish to attract and address a particular niche.

There are some factors that need to be taken into consideration in case of the A/B testing of landing page namely?
When doing experimental tests on the landing pages, it suggested that one experiment with the Headlines, Call to actions, image, fields, layout and the color of the page. Set each variable to change and begin from one to focus on changes that might have occurred and how they may affect the results.
